Output 3db329475e14dc99171696e4f458f7043426762f41ad0f74d5a316e3e990e5c1:9

value
10428306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c18ce5a17d7d1da59aa71ff8ef02a68c651e306 OP_EQUAL
address
34FaZUEm2brSL42vCRweHF2u9s4jQzSmfo
transaction
3db329475e14dc99171696e4f458f7043426762f41ad0f74d5a316e3e990e5c1
spent
true